Cost to Own a Home in La Pine, Oregon

A $327,000 home here costs

$2,363

per month, all in — with 20% down at today's 6.66% 30-year fixed rate.

A standard mortgage calculator would have told you $1,681. The real number is $682 higher every month — 41% more than the payment most buyers budget for.

Where every dollar goes

Only the first line is a mortgage payment. Change any assumption above and every figure below recalculates.

Principal & interest30-year fixed, $261,600 borrowed $1,681
Property tax0.543% effective rate for La Pine itself $148
Homeowners insuranceOregon averages $793/yr (NAIC), or 0.173% of home value $47
Electricity16.27¢/kWh — Oregon residential average, EIA $146
Water, sewer & trashUS household average $68
Maintenance reserve1% of home value per year $273
Total monthly $2,363

The weather behind that power bill

La Pine sits in Deschutes County, which averages a high of 84.1°F in its hottest month and a low of 19.0°F in its coldest, with 19.12" of precipitation a year and 44% of it in a single three-month stretch. That climate drives 85 cooling and 7,661 heating degree days, which is what sets the $146 electricity line above.

Common questions

How much does it cost to own a home in La Pine?

A $327,000 home in La Pine, Oregon costs approximately $2,363 per month with 20% down at 6.66%. That is $1,681 principal and interest, $148 property tax, $47 homeowners insurance, $214 utilities and $273 set aside for maintenance.

What is the property tax rate in La Pine?

La Pine has an effective property tax rate of 0.543%, based on a median home value of $327,100 and median real estate taxes of $1,776. That is lower than the Deschutes County average of 0.616%.

What is the average home price in La Pine?

The median owner-occupied home value in La Pine, Oregon is $327,100, against $596,000 across Deschutes County.

Is it cheaper to rent or buy in La Pine?

Median gross rent in La Pine is $1,046 a month, against $2,363 to own the median home all in. Renting costs less month to month here, though renting builds no equity.
